Transaction eefd64d91ea88cdab92451704a04627dd7afdf50557deec2b4a14550642d6cee
1 Input
1 Output
-
eefd64d91ea88cdab92451704a04627dd7afdf50557deec2b4a14550642d6cee:0
- value
- 2355516
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ab733c15c580676c01193cff1af2297e6e1ddc9
- address
- bc1qd2mn8s2utqr8dsq3j08lrtezjlnwrhwf3ll99u